'San Mateo County Strong -
Small Business Grant Program' Round 2
The San Mateo County Board of Supervisors recently approved an amended second round of grants for San Mateo County Strong’s Small Business Grant Program. This program provides funding for small businesses that have not received any assistance from the County, State, or Federal COVID-19-relief programs in the past 12 months.

Menlo Park Community Campus
Groundbreaking Ceremony
The Menlo Park Community Campus is a state-of-the-art community facility planned at the site of the former Onetta Harris Community Center, Menlo Park Senior Center, Belle Haven Pool, and Belle Haven Youth Center. A new multigenerational facility is slated to open in 2023 and will include a recreation center, gymnasium, senior center, afterschool child care, fitness center, pool, branch library, teen space, maker space, and community meeting rooms. The new facility will be all-electric, including solar panels to generate renewable energy for use on-site, and is being constructed to emergency shelter standards.

This groundbreaking ceremony is a celebration of the project made possible by the community, the City of Menlo Park, and the generous support of Facebook.
